Tropical Storm Bertha Hits Louisiana
On Wednesday afternoon, Tropical Storm Bertha struck St. Bernard Parish, situated southeast of New Orleans, with maximum sustained winds recorded at 45 mph (approximately 75 km/h). Although the storm has begun to weaken, it has generated hazardous weather conditions that extended far beyond its centre, prompting beach closures from Florida to Mississippi. Catastrophic Conditions in the Appalachian States
Simultaneously, Kentucky and West Virginia faced a deluge of catastrophic events. The severe weather system that swept through the region resulted in multiple tornadoes and record-setting flash floods. Rescuers were inundated with emergency calls as rising waters trapped individuals in their homes and vehicles. In one West Virginia county, first responders resorted to cutting through roofs to reach those stranded.
Governor Patrick Morrisey declared a state of emergency across all 55 counties in West Virginia, dispatching 100 members of the National Guard to assist in the hardest-hit areas. An additional 200 troops were scheduled to arrive, further bolstering recovery efforts. “State and local agencies will remain on the ground for as long as it takes to help affected communities,” Morrisey affirmed in a statement, demonstrating a commitment to aid those in distress.
Widespread Damage and Response Efforts
Reports from Kentucky indicated widespread devastation, including landslides, flash flooding, and significant damage to infrastructure. In Grayson County, officials noted that multiple individuals sustained injuries, with at least one requiring hospitalisation. The area faced severe structural damage, with up to 25 buildings reported as either heavily damaged or completely destroyed.
As the storm’s aftereffects continued to impact the region, residents in Buckhannon, West Virginia, described the flooding as “catastrophic.” The Sand Run stream reached a record crest of 10.63 feet (3.24 meters), surpassing the previous high set in 1985. Eyewitness accounts reported chaotic scenes: families trapped in rising waters, vehicles abandoned, and homes colliding. Mayor Robbie Skinner stated, “I’ve never seen anything like this, and I’ve lived here for 37 years. The river is still rising; we’re not done yet.”
Rescue teams employed swift boats to navigate through the inundated areas, cutting holes in roofs to assist those trapped in attics. Meanwhile, tens of thousands of residents across Ohio, Virginia, and West Virginia remained without power, reflecting the widespread impact of this devastating weather event.
The Broader Weather Threat
The National Weather Service (NWS) indicated that while the immediate threat in Kentucky and West Virginia was significant, the impact of this extreme weather was expected to shift further south into Virginia and North Carolina. As the remnants of Tropical Storm Bertha continue to move across the eastern United States, the potential for further severe weather looms large.
The NWS has announced plans to conduct damage assessments across at least four regions and seven counties in Kentucky, aiming to gauge the full extent of the destruction.
